Historical & Cultural Background

The name Briston is of English origin, derived from the Old English elements "brycg," meaning "bridge," and "tun," meaning "enclosure" or "settlement." This etymology suggests that the name originally referred to a settlement near a bridge or a place where a bridge was significant. The name likely evolved through various forms, including the Middle English "Bryston," before settling into its current form in modern English.

The transition into English can be traced back to the early medieval period when Old English was the dominant language in England, particularly from the 5th to the 11th centuries. U.S. Historical Usage

The name Briston was first seen in the United States in 1982. Briston has ranked as high as #1328 nationally, which occurred in 2010, and has been most popular in . In the past 5 years the name Briston has been trending down compared to the previous 5 years.
